What’s The Difference Between Callaloo And Spinach?

What’s The Difference Between Callaloo And Spinach? Callaloo is a leafy, spinach-like vegetable. The variety of callaloo Amaranthus viridis, better known as Chinese spinach or Indian kale, should not be confused with the callaloo found in the eastern Caribbean, which refers to the leaves of the dasheen plant. What Are The Benefits Of Kale And Spinach?

What Are The Benefits Of Kale And Spinach? Kale and spinach are highly nutritious and and associated with several benefits. While kale offers more than twice the amount of vitamin C as spinach, spinach provides more folate and vitamins A and K. What Chemicals Does Spinach Contain?

What Chemicals Does Spinach Contain? Spinach is a superior supplier of vitamin K, vitamin A, manganese, magnesium, folic acid, iron, vitamin C, vitamin B2, and potassium, and it includes a lot of dietary fiber, vitamin B6, vitamin E, and omega-3 fatty acids, which are essential for the maintenance, improvement, and regulation of human tissues. What Is Another Name For Malabar Spinach?

What Is Another Name For Malabar Spinach? Basella alba goes by many other common names besides Malabar spinach, including Ceylon spinach, Indian spinach, vine spinach, and Malabar nightshade.
